In computer science, a registry is storage space for units of memory for immediate use. Explore the types of registers, including shift registers, their defining characteristics, functions, and examples. Create an account Table of Contents What Are Registers? What Are Shift Registers? Shift Regi...
The Central Processing Unit (CPU) is the heart of a computer and it executes program codes, does arithmetic calculations, logical comparisons as instructed, and store the final outcome in storage. It takes data and executable instructions from the main memory and processes them. While doing so i...
This will cause a full system reset of the CPU and all other components in the device. See Reset management on page B1-240 for more information. Default Value: 0 Clears all active state information for fixed and configurable exceptions. The effect of writing a 1 to this bit if the ...
CPU Core Register Access (CMSIS) This page will show you how to access SAM MCU Peripheral registers and bit fields in C, without the use of any framework, such asAdvanced Software Framework(ASF3) orSTART. Additionally, you will learn how to access the SAM CPU-based peripherals using the ...
The eight general-purpose registers in the x86 processor family each have a unique purpose. Each register has special instructions and opcodes which make fulfilling this purpose more convenient or efficient. The registers and their uses are shown briefly below: ...
First, what sizes are eax, ax, ah and their counterparts, in the 64-bit architecture? How to access a single register's byte and how to access all the 64-bit register's eight bytes? I'd love attention for both x86-64 (x64) and Itanium processors. Second, what is the correct way...
This project provides Linux, macOS, and Windows kernel modules to read and write selected system registers from user applications. Warning:This project is for educational purpose only, for people wanting to increase their knowledge in the Arm64 architecture. Loading a custom kernel module may always...
gcc actually uses it in functions with a frame pointer, when it can't just pop rbp). Also the horribly-slow enter which nobody ever uses. rsp: stack operations: push/pop/call/ret, and leave. (And enter). And in kernel mode (not user space) asynchronous use by hardware to save ...
When the device hangs, always fails in the readl() or writel() functions. I cannot provide debug lines inside the readl() or writel() because if I add it the system does not boot, I assume that these are low level functions that works in ...
I've created my own little "CPU". Works fine under ModelSim. I now want to upload it to my FPGA but notice that I have the newbie problem "Total Logic Elements 0" and the warning "Info (17049): 296 registers lost all their fanouts during netlist optimizations." ...